RAID 0, 1, 5, 6 ve 10 Aras\u0131ndaki Farklar"},"content":{"rendered":"<p>RAID, birden fazla fiziksel diski performans, veri s\u00fcreklili\u011fi veya her ikisini geli\u015ftirmek amac\u0131yla tek bir mant\u0131ksal depolama yap\u0131s\u0131 alt\u0131nda birle\u015ftiren teknolojidir. \u201cRedundant Array of Independent Disks\u201d ifadesinin k\u0131saltmas\u0131d\u0131r. RAID 0, RAID 1, RAID 5, RAID 6 ve RAID 10 gibi seviyeler veriyi disklere farkl\u0131 y\u00f6ntemlerle da\u011f\u0131t\u0131r.<\/p>\n<p>Her RAID seviyesi ayn\u0131 korumay\u0131 sa\u011flamaz. Baz\u0131lar\u0131 okuma-yazma h\u0131z\u0131n\u0131 art\u0131r\u0131rken baz\u0131lar\u0131 disk ar\u0131zas\u0131na kar\u015f\u0131 yedeklilik sunar. Bu nedenle \u201cen iyi RAID hangisi?\u201d sorusunun tek bir cevab\u0131 yoktur; do\u011fru se\u00e7im kullan\u0131labilir disk say\u0131s\u0131na, kapasite ihtiyac\u0131na, i\u015f y\u00fck\u00fcne ve kabul edilebilir kesinti riskine g\u00f6re yap\u0131lmal\u0131d\u0131r.<\/p>\n<div id=\"ez-toc-container\" class=\"ez-toc-v2_0_73 ez-toc-wrap-left counter-flat ez-toc-counter ez-toc-white class=\"ez-toc-section\" id=\"RAID_Nedir_ve_Nasil_Calisir\"><\/span>RAID Nedir ve Nas\u0131l \u00c7al\u0131\u015f\u0131r?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p>RAID yap\u0131s\u0131nda i\u015fletim sistemi birden fazla diski \u00e7o\u011fu zaman tek bir mant\u0131ksal s\u00fcr\u00fcc\u00fc olarak g\u00f6r\u00fcr. Veriler en az iki diske b\u00f6l\u00fcnerek yaz\u0131ld\u0131\u011f\u0131 i\u00e7in y\u00fcksek s\u0131ral\u0131 okuma ve yazma performans\u0131 sa\u011flayabilir. Ancak yedeklilik sunmaz. Dizideki tek bir diskin ar\u0131zalanmas\u0131 b\u00fct\u00fcn verinin kullan\u0131lamaz h\u00e2le gelmesine yol a\u00e7abilir.<\/p>\n<p>Bu nedenle RAID 0, kolayca yeniden \u00fcretilebilen ge\u00e7ici veriler veya performans\u0131n veri s\u00fcreklili\u011finden daha \u00f6nemli oldu\u011fu i\u015f y\u00fckleri i\u00e7in d\u00fc\u015f\u00fcn\u00fclmelidir. Kritik m\u00fc\u015fteri verileri ve tek kopya yedekler i\u00e7in uygun de\u011fildir.<\/p>\n<h2><span class=\"ez-toc-section\" id=\"RAID_1_Nedir\"><\/span>RAID 1 Nedir?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p>RAID 1 mirroring kullan\u0131r ve ayn\u0131 veriyi iki ya da daha fazla diske yazar. \u0130ki diskli standart bir yap\u0131da kullan\u0131labilir kapasite, tek diskin kapasitesi kadard\u0131r. Disklerden biri ar\u0131zaland\u0131\u011f\u0131nda sistem di\u011fer kopya \u00fczerinden \u00e7al\u0131\u015fmaya devam edebilir.<\/p>\n<p>Basit yap\u0131s\u0131, h\u0131zl\u0131 geri d\u00f6n\u00fc\u015f imk\u00e2n\u0131 ve okuma performans\u0131 nedeniyle i\u015fletim sistemi diskleri, k\u00fc\u00e7\u00fck veritabanlar\u0131 ve y\u00f6netim sunucular\u0131 i\u00e7in s\u0131k tercih edilir. Kapasite verimlili\u011fi ise d\u00fc\u015f\u00fckt\u00fcr; iki diskin toplam alan\u0131n\u0131n yakla\u015f\u0131k yar\u0131s\u0131 kullan\u0131labilir.<\/p>\n<h2><span class=\"ez-toc-section\" id=\"RAID_5_Nedir_ve_Kac_Disk_Gerektirir\"><\/span>RAID 5 Nedir ve Ka\u00e7 Disk Gerektirir?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p>RAID 5 en az \u00fc\u00e7 disk gerektirir. Veri ve parity bilgisi b\u00fct\u00fcn disklere da\u011f\u0131t\u0131l\u0131r. Dizideki bir disk ar\u0131zaland\u0131\u011f\u0131nda eksik veri kalan diskler ve parity bilgisi kullan\u0131larak yeniden olu\u015fturulabilir.<\/p>\n<p>RAID 5 kapasite verimlili\u011fi ile yedeklilik aras\u0131nda denge sa\u011flar. Kullan\u0131labilir kapasite yakla\u015f\u0131k olarak <code>(disk say\u0131s\u0131 - 1) \u00d7 en k\u00fc\u00e7\u00fck disk kapasitesi<\/code> form\u00fcl\u00fcyle hesaplan\u0131r. Ancak k\u00fc\u00e7\u00fck rastgele yazmalarda parity hesab\u0131 ek y\u00fck olu\u015fturur. B\u00fcy\u00fck disklerde yeniden olu\u015fturma s\u00fcresinin uzun olmas\u0131 da ikinci ar\u0131za riskini art\u0131rabilir.<\/p>\n<h2><span class=\"ez-toc-section\" id=\"RAID_6_Nedir_ve_RAID_5ten_Farki_Nedir\"><\/span>RAID 6 Nedir ve RAID 5\u2019ten Fark\u0131 Nedir?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p>RAID 6 en az d\u00f6rt diskle kurulur ve \u00e7ift parity kullan\u0131r. Ayn\u0131 anda iki diskin ar\u0131zalanmas\u0131na dayanabilir. Buna kar\u015f\u0131l\u0131k iki disk kapasitesi parity i\u00e7in ayr\u0131l\u0131r ve yazma i\u015flemlerinde RAID 5\u2019e g\u00f6re daha fazla hesaplama yap\u0131l\u0131r.<\/p>\n<p>\u00c7ok say\u0131da b\u00fcy\u00fck kapasiteli diskin bulundu\u011fu yap\u0131larda, uzun rebuild s\u00fcresi nedeniyle RAID 6 daha g\u00fcvenli olabilir. Kapasite hesab\u0131 yakla\u015f\u0131k olarak <code>(disk say\u0131s\u0131 - 2) \u00d7 en k\u00fc\u00e7\u00fck disk kapasitesi<\/code> \u015feklindedir.<\/p>\n<h2><span class=\"ez-toc-section\" id=\"RAID_10_Nedir_ve_Minimum_Kac_Disk_Kullanir\"><\/span>RAID 10 Nedir ve Minimum Ka\u00e7 Disk Kullan\u0131r?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p>RAID 10, RAID 1\u2019in mirroring \u00f6zelli\u011fini RAID 0\u2019\u0131n striping yap\u0131s\u0131yla birle\u015ftirir. En az d\u00f6rt disk gerekir. Veriler \u00f6nce aynalan\u0131r, ard\u0131ndan ayna \u00e7iftleri aras\u0131nda da\u011f\u0131t\u0131l\u0131r.<\/p>\n<p>Y\u00fcksek rastgele okuma-yazma performans\u0131 ve h\u0131zl\u0131 rebuild avantaj\u0131 nedeniyle yo\u011fun veritabanlar\u0131, sanalla\u015ft\u0131rma platformlar\u0131 ve i\u015flem trafi\u011fi y\u00fcksek uygulamalarda tercih edilir. Kullan\u0131labilir kapasite toplam ham kapasitenin yakla\u015f\u0131k yar\u0131s\u0131d\u0131r.<\/p>\n<h2><span class=\"ez-toc-section\" id=\"RAID_Seviyeleri_Arasindaki_Farklar_Nelerdir\"><\/span>RAID Seviyeleri Aras\u0131ndaki Farklar Nelerdir?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<table>\n<thead>\n<tr>\n<th>Seviye<\/th>\n<th>Minimum disk<\/th>\n<th>Ar\u0131za tolerans\u0131<\/th>\n<th>\u00d6ne \u00e7\u0131kan \u00f6zellik<\/th>\n<\/tr>\n<\/thead>\n<tbody>\n<tr>\n<td>RAID 0<\/td>\n<td>2<\/td>\n<td>Yok<\/td>\n<td>Y\u00fcksek performans ve tam kapasite<\/td>\n<\/tr>\n<tr>\n<td>RAID 1<\/td>\n<td>2<\/td>\n<td>Ayna \u00e7iftinde 1 disk<\/td>\n<td>Basit yedeklilik ve h\u0131zl\u0131 kurtarma<\/td>\n<\/tr>\n<tr>\n<td>RAID 5<\/td>\n<td>3<\/td>\n<td>1 disk<\/td>\n<td>Kapasite ve koruma dengesi<\/td>\n<\/tr>\n<tr>\n<td>RAID 6<\/td>\n<td>4<\/td>\n<td>2 disk<\/td>\n<td>B\u00fcy\u00fck dizilerde daha y\u00fcksek tolerans<\/td>\n<\/tr>\n<tr>\n<td>RAID 10<\/td>\n<td>4<\/td>\n<td>Ayna \u00e7iftlerine ba\u011fl\u0131<\/td>\n<td>Performans ve yedeklilik<\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<p>Tablodaki ar\u0131za tolerans\u0131 tek ba\u015f\u0131na yeterli se\u00e7im kriteri de\u011fildir. Disk kapasitesi, denetleyici performans\u0131, uygulaman\u0131n yazma yo\u011funlu\u011fu, rebuild s\u00fcresi ve yedekleme politikas\u0131 birlikte de\u011ferlendirilmelidir.<\/p>\n<h2><span class=\"ez-toc-section\" id=\"Donanimsal_RAID_ile_Yazilimsal_RAID_Arasindaki_Fark_Nedir\"><\/span>Donan\u0131msal RAID ile Yaz\u0131l\u0131msal RAID Aras\u0131ndaki Fark Nedir?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p><strong>Donan\u0131msal RAID<\/strong>, diskleri \u00f6zel bir RAID denetleyicisi \u00fczerinden y\u00f6netir. Denetleyicinin \u00f6nbelle\u011fi ve g\u00fc\u00e7 korumal\u0131 yazma \u00f6zellikleri performans sa\u011flayabilir. Ar\u0131za h\u00e2linde ayn\u0131 veya uyumlu denetleyiciye ihtiya\u00e7 duyulmas\u0131 ise operasyonel ba\u011f\u0131ml\u0131l\u0131k olu\u015fturabilir.<\/p>\n<p><strong>Yaz\u0131l\u0131msal RAID<\/strong>, i\u015fletim sistemi taraf\u0131ndan y\u00f6netilir. Modern i\u015flemcilerde bir\u00e7ok i\u015f y\u00fck\u00fc i\u00e7in yeterli performans sunar ve yap\u0131land\u0131rman\u0131n farkl\u0131 donan\u0131ma ta\u015f\u0131nmas\u0131 daha kolay olabilir. Buna kar\u015f\u0131l\u0131k kaynak kullan\u0131m\u0131 ve a\u00e7\u0131l\u0131\u015f\/kurtarma prosed\u00fcrleri dikkatle planlanmal\u0131d\u0131r.<\/p>\n<h2><span class=\"ez-toc-section\" id=\"SSD_ve_NVMe_Disklerde_RAID_Kullanilir_mi\"><\/span>SSD ve NVMe Disklerde RAID Kullan\u0131l\u0131r m\u0131?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p>Evet. SSD ve NVMe diskler RAID i\u00e7inde kullan\u0131labilir. Fakat y\u00fcksek h\u0131zl\u0131 NVMe s\u00fcr\u00fcc\u00fclerde denetleyici, PCIe ba\u011flant\u0131lar\u0131 veya yaz\u0131l\u0131m katman\u0131 darbo\u011faz olu\u015fturabilir. Kritik sistemlerde disk de\u011fi\u015fimi \u00f6ncesinde g\u00fcncel ve do\u011frulanm\u0131\u015f yedek bulunmal\u0131d\u0131r. Birden fazla disk hatas\u0131 veya bozuk metadata varsa deneme-yan\u0131lma yapmak yerine profesyonel veri kurtarma deste\u011fi al\u0131nmal\u0131d\u0131r.<\/p>\n<figure class=\"wp-block-image size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"1424\" height=\"792\" src=\"https:\/\/verimin.com.tr\/blog\/wp-content\/uploads\/2026\/07\/raid-yedekleme-yerine-gecer-mi-verimin.png\" alt=\"RAID Yedekleme Yerine Ge\u00e7er mi? \u2013 RAID ile ba\u011f\u0131ms\u0131z yedekleme aras\u0131ndaki fark\u0131 \u00f6\u011frenin.\" class=\"wp-image-1572\" srcset=\"https:\/\/verimin.com.tr\/blog\/wp-content\/uploads\/2026\/07\/raid-yedekleme-yerine-gecer-mi-verimin.png 1424w, https:\/\/verimin.com.tr\/blog\/wp-content\/uploads\/2026\/07\/raid-yedekleme-yerine-gecer-mi-verimin-300x167.png 300w, https:\/\/verimin.com.tr\/blog\/wp-content\/uploads\/2026\/07\/raid-yedekleme-yerine-gecer-mi-verimin-1024x570.png 1024w, https:\/\/verimin.com.tr\/blog\/wp-content\/uploads\/2026\/07\/raid-yedekleme-yerine-gecer-mi-verimin-768x427.png 768w\" sizes=\"auto, (max-width: 1424px) 100vw, 1424px\" \/><\/figure>\n<h2><span class=\"ez-toc-section\" id=\"RAID_Yedekleme_Yerine_Gecer_mi\"><\/span>RAID Yedekleme Yerine Ge\u00e7er mi?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p>Hay\u0131r. RAID yaln\u0131zca belirli disk ar\u0131zalar\u0131na kar\u015f\u0131 hizmet s\u00fcreklili\u011fi sa\u011flar.
